Transaction 750cbc8564a39477453894f3944cf0eb2a8ec83fad99c17b1842208320095b79

1 Input
2 Outputs
  • 750cbc8564a39477453894f3944cf0eb2a8ec83fad99c17b1842208320095b79:0
  • value  814911
    address  1Aubc6xrA4fSX1c1a1miY39jwGZ9B4HWDk
  • 750cbc8564a39477453894f3944cf0eb2a8ec83fad99c17b1842208320095b79:1
  • value  76284459
    address  38NWPeE74FeCnU8SnuaAmS6fqzVuHSViU9